+Installation, Unix
+------------------
+
+Make sure you have a C and C++ compiler available. gcc and g++ work fine.
+
+Before compilation can take place YAZ must be installed. It goes, roughly,
+like this:
+
+ $ cd yaz-<version>
$ ./configure
$ make
+ $ su
+ # make install
+ $ ^D
+ $ cd ..
+
+The YAZ proxy uses a configuration file in XML and libxml2 and libxslt
+is required in order for the config facility to work. Many systems already
+have libxml2/libxslt installed. In that, case remember to get the devel
+version of that as well (not just the runtime). Libxml2/libxslt can also be
+compiled easily on most systems. See http://www.xmlsoft.org/ for more
+information.
+
+Then, build YAZ++:
+
+ $ cd yaz++-<version>
+ $ ./configure
+ $ make
+
+If you do have libxslt installed and configure above does not find it,
+use option --with-xslt=PREFIX to specify location of libxslt and libxml2.
+yaz++ configure looks for PREFIX/bin/xslt-config.

+About the proxy
+---------------
+
+For the proxy the actual target is determined in by the OtherInfo
+part of the InitRequest. We've defined an OID for this which we call
+PROXY. The OID is 1.2.840.10003.10.1000.81.1.
+
+ OtherInformation ::= [201] IMPLICIT SEQUENCE OF SEQUENCE{
+ category [1] IMPLICIT InfoCategory OPTIONAL,
+ information CHOICE{
+ characterInfo [2] IMPLICIT InternationalString,
+ binaryInfo [3] IMPLICIT OCTET STRING,
+ externallyDefinedInfo [4] IMPLICIT EXTERNAL,
+ oid [5] IMPLICIT OBJECT IDENTIFIER}}
+--
+ InfoCategory ::= SEQUENCE{
+ categoryTypeId [1] IMPLICIT OBJECT IDENTIFIER OPTIONAL,
+ categoryValue [2] IMPLICIT INTEGER}
+
+The InfoCategory is present with categoryTypeId set to the PROXY OID
+and categoryValue set to 0. The information in OtherInformation uses
+characterInfo to represent the target using the form target[:port][/db].
+
+For clients that don't set the PROXY OtherInformation, a default
+target can be specified using option -t for proxy.
+
+Example:
+ We start the proxy so that it listens on port 9000. The default
+ target is Bell Labs Library unless it is overridden by a client in
+ the InitRequest.
+
+ $ ./yaz-proxy -t z3950.bell-labs.com/books @:9000
+
+ The client is started and talks to the proxy without specifying
+ a target. Hence this client will talk to the Bell Labs server.
+
+ $ ./yaz-client localhost:9000
+
+ The client is started and it specifies the actual target itself.
+
+ $ ./yaz-client -p localhost:9000 bagel.indexdata.dk/gils
+
+ For ZAP the equivalent would be
+ proxy=localhost:9000
+ target=bagel.indexdata.dk/gils
+ Simple, huh!

+ZOOM-C++
+--------
+The ZOOM library in this distribution implements the ZOOM C++ binding
+described on the ZOOM web-site at
+ http://zoom.z3950.org/bind/cplusplus/index.html
+It provides a simple but powerful API for constructing Z39.50 client
+applications. See the documentation in doc/zoom.xml for much more
+information.
